Product Overview
The Mitsubishi CNV2E-9P-8M is a high-performance encoder cable specifically designed for CNC servo motor applications in industrial automation systems. This specialized cable ensures reliable signal transmission between servo motors and their corresponding controllers, maintaining precision and accuracy in motion control applications.
As part of Mitsubishi's comprehensive industrial automation portfolio, the CNV2E-9P-8M features robust construction with pure copper conductors and gold-plated contacts, providing exceptional durability and signal integrity in demanding industrial environments.

Technical Specifications
Parameter
Specification
Brand Name
MITSUBISHI
Model Number
CNV2E-9P-8M
Product Type
Encoder Cable
Cable Length
8 meters
Conductor Material
Pure Copper
Contact Plating
Gold Plated
Wire Type
Signal Wire
Flexibility Rating
10 million cycles
Compatible Systems
Mitsubishi M70, CNC servo systems
Condition
New In Box
Key Features and Benefits
Enhanced Signal Integrity
The CNV2E-9P-8M utilizes high-quality pure copper conductors with gold-plated contacts to ensure minimal signal loss and maximum transmission accuracy. This is critical for encoder signals where precision is paramount in CNC applications.
Durability and Reliability
With a flexibility rating of 10 million cycles, this cable is designed to withstand the constant motion and vibration typical in industrial automation environments. The robust construction ensures long-term reliability in demanding applications.
Compatibility
Specifically designed for Mitsubishi CNC servo systems, particularly the M70 series, ensuring seamless integration and optimal performance with Mitsubishi industrial automation equipment.
Standardized Length
The 8-meter length provides optimal flexibility for various machine configurations while maintaining signal quality over distance, making it suitable for a wide range of industrial setups.

Frequently Asked Questions (FAQ)
What is the primary function of the CNV2E-9P-8M cable?
The CNV2E-9P-8M is an encoder cable designed to transmit position and speed feedback signals from servo motors to CNC controllers in Mitsubishi automation systems, ensuring precise motion control.
What does the "8M" in the model number indicate?
The "8M" indicates the cable length of 8 meters, which is a standard length optimized for various industrial machine configurations.
Is this cable compatible with non-Mitsubishi systems?
While specifically designed for Mitsubishi systems, the cable may be compatible with other systems using similar encoder interfaces, but optimal performance is guaranteed only with Mitsubishi equipment.
What maintenance is required for this cable?
The cable requires minimal maintenance. Regular visual inspection for physical damage and ensuring proper cable routing to prevent excessive bending or strain is recommended.
What is the significance of gold-plated contacts?
Gold plating provides superior corrosion resistance, excellent electrical conductivity, and reliable contact performance over extended periods, ensuring consistent signal transmission.
